Board approves Bowman proposal to replace monuments and master signage

River Ridge Community Development District · October 22, 2024

Summary

The board approved Bowman Consulting Group’s landscape architecture proposal to replace monuments and master signage across Pelican Sound, with neighborhood monument costs budgeted under replacement reserves and some monuments slated for relocation.

Eric Long presented the Bowman Consulting Group proposal for landscape architecture services to implement the Pelican Sound Master Signage Program. The scope covers replacement of all monuments throughout the CDD, including neighborhood monuments; some signs are foam and others stone, and several monuments will be relocated for design or site‑specific reasons.

Mr. Krebs noted design and permitting considerations, and Mr. Long said neighborhood monument replacements, design and permitting costs are budgeted under Pelican Sound replacement reserves. On motion by Mr. Blumenthal and seconded by Mr. Schultz, "with all in favor," the board approved the Bowman Consulting Group proposal.

Staff will coordinate monument designs and provide neighborhoods with guardhouse renderings and project information when appropriate.
